Comment créer une interface graphique simplement pour un programme en C sous lin
cs_zarzar
Messages postés38Date d'inscriptiondimanche 29 juin 2003StatutMembreDernière intervention 7 juillet 2006
-
20 sept. 2004 à 17:30
somayya
Messages postés1Date d'inscriptionlundi 3 mars 2008StatutMembreDernière intervention 3 mars 2008
-
3 mars 2008 à 14:55
bonjour
je dois écrire un programme de traitement d'image BMP en C sous linux qui pour l'instant doit tourner en "ligne de commande"
j'ai des fonctions main, rotation, luminosité, etc.. avec les .c et .h nécessaires et tout
j'aimerais (parce que c'est quand meme plus sympa!) créer une interface graphique avec des boutons et avec l'image qui donne un aperçu direct de l'application des filtes de traitements (parce que actuellement c'est blabla img.bmp, ok ca genere un fichier img_bis.bmp mais on n'a plus qu'a l'ouvrir pr voir le résultat)
comment peut-on faire pour integrer facilement le code alors dans une fenetre avec qq boutons (qui lanceront chacun une des fonctions et avoir l'affichage au milieu du fichier image) ?
merci d'avance pour votre aide
A voir également:
Comment créer une interface graphique simplement pour un programme en C sous lin
cs_Nebula
Messages postés787Date d'inscriptionsamedi 8 juin 2002StatutMembreDernière intervention 7 juin 20072 20 sept. 2004 à 17:56
Tu peux essayer avec GTK, un toolkit sympa utilisé par Gnome, avec une API native C (qui a été portée en C++ et d'autres langages), voir ce site pour apprendre : http://www.gtk-fr.org/
Il y a aussi Qt sous Linux, qui est utilisé sous KDE. L'API est en C++ et le rendu un poil plus rapide que GTK, mais c'est pas "libre" (enfin, de nombreux trolls en parlent).
A toi de voir, pour ma part je te conseillerais GTK pour C et Qt ou WxWindows pour C++ ;-)